Web6 apr. 2024 · Remove as much paint as possible with the heat gun and metal scrapers. Start on the lowest setting and hold the heat gun far away from the furniture until you get a feel for the heat gun. The weakest paint will begin to curl up. In more difficult areas, gently scrape with a metal scraper. The paint should soften and become clay-like, which can ... WebWhat is the best way to remove paint from wood? The tool has a flat steel blade and a handle of wood, plastic, or metal. Its uses are many, among them removing wallpaper or paint after they've been softened with heat, and it can be wielded in a grip similar to that you use to hold a screwdriver.
